Understanding Duplicate Content: What Google Considers

What is Duplicate Content?

Duplicate material describes blocks of text or media that appear on several web pages either within a single domain or across different domains. Google specifies it as any significant part of content that is identical or really similar across different URLs. This problem can cause confusion for online search engine about which page to index or display screen in search results.

Why Does Google Care About Duplicate Content?

Google intends to supply the very best possible experience for its users. When several pages use the very same content, it muddles search results and can possibly irritate users seeking unique info. Google's algorithms make every effort to make sure that users receive diverse options instead of numerous listings for the exact same material.

How Does Duplicate Material Affect SEO?

Loss of Ranking Potential

One major effect of replicate content is lost ranking potential. When Google comes across several versions of the same material, it might select to disregard all but one variation from the index, meaning your carefully crafted posts may never ever see the light of day in search results.

Dilution of Link Equity

Link equity refers to the worth passed from one page to another through links. If several pages share the same material and receive backlinks, then link equity gets watered down amongst those pages rather of combining onto a single reliable source.

Common Types of Duplicate Content

Internal Duplication

This happens when similar content exists on different URLs within your own website. For example:

  • Different URLs leading to the same item description
  • Printer-friendly variations of articles

External Duplication

External duplication happens when other sites copy your original material without authorization, leading to competition in search rankings.

How Would You Minimize Duplicate Content?

There are several techniques you can employ:

  • Canonical Tags: Utilize these HTML components to indicate which version of a page ought to be thought about the reliable source.
  • 301 Redirects: Implement redirects from duplicate pages to point visitors (and online search engine) towards the original.
  • Consistent URL Structures: Stick with a consistent format for URLs-- prevent unnecessary specifications or variations.

    The Many Reliable Fixes for Duplicate Material Issues

    Using 301 Reroutes Effectively

    Implementing 301 redirects is a reliable way to notify search engines that a page has permanently moved somewhere else. This guarantees traffic circulations smoothly to your preferred URL without losing valuable link equity.

    Employing Canonical Tags Wisely

    Canonical tags inform online search engine which variation of a webpage they need to index when there are multiple variations available. This easy line of code can save you from significant headaches down the line.
